Martin P3M-2
Glenn L. Martin Company · United States · first flew 1931 · transport aircraft
The Martin P3M-2 is the improved follow-on to the P3M-1 patrol flying boat, incorporating refined engine installations and detail improvements for better performance and reliability. It continued the transition from biplane to monoplane patrol boats in the early 1930s US Navy.

Spot it by:
- Improved three-engine monoplane patrol flying boat
- Refined engine nacelles over P3M-1
- Early 1930s US Navy patrol boat bridging biplane and modern eras
Essentially identical in profile to the P3M-1; the very large span monoplane wing, triple engine layout, and twin-tail flying boat hull form are the key recognition features.
Specifications
- The Martin P3M-2 has a length of 17.37 m (57 ft).
- It has a wingspan of 36.88 m (121 ft).
- Its maximum speed is 209 km/h (130 mph).
- Typical crew: 6.

History
Building on experience with the P3M-1, the P3M-2 introduced more powerful engines and refinements to the fuel and systems installations. Both P3M variants served in parallel before being replaced by the Consolidated P2Y and later Consolidated PBY Catalina.
Variants
The P3M-2 was the final member of the P3M series; subsequent Martin patrol flying boat development led to the much larger PBM Mariner.
Where you'll see it
Served with US Navy patrol squadrons in the early-to-mid 1930s, overlapping with the introduction of the PBY Catalina which would take the patrol boat role to new levels of capability.
